Pion-Nucleon Scattering at Low Energies
Abstract
We study pion-nucleon scattering at tree level with a chiral lagrangian of pions, nucleons, and -isobars using a K-matrix unitarization procedure. Evaluating the scattering amplitude to order Q2, where Q is a generic small momentum scale, we obtain a good fit to the experimental phase shifts for pion center-of-mass kinetic energies up to 50 MeV. The fit can be extended to 150 MeV when we include the order-Q3 contributions. Our results are independent of the off-shell parameter.
